Alexander Skarsgård and Jack McBrayer

Alexander Skarsgård and Jack McBrayer happily posing together at the SAG Awards


Rachel Murray / Getty Images

Suggested by: amandabretches

Their backstory: SkarsgÃ¥rd and McBrayer were neighbors in Los Angeles around the time SkarsgÃ¥rd was on True Blood. In a 2019 interview, he revealed the pretty unusual way his friendship with McBrayer started. He said: “[McBrayer] had a telescope fixed on my house that was on the other side of a canyon. I didn’t have a TV when I moved in, [so] there were a couple of months I got one — when I turned it on, I got a phone call a second [later], and [McBrayer said]: ‘You got a television.'”

Samuel L. Jackson and Judge Judy Sheindlin

Samuel L. Jackson and Judge Judy at the Annual Women's Guild Cedars-Sinai Gala in 2012


Jason Merritt / Getty Images

Suggested by: dizedd

Their backstory: Jackson and Sheindlin met a while back through Jackson’s agent, and have spent countless years hanging out together (mostly over dinner). Sheindlin even helped Jackson quit smoking — on WWHL in 2017, he said: “We used to smoke together, and when Judy stopped smoking, she made me stop smoking. She sent me to her doctor in White Plains, who actually treats you with sodium thiopental, and I quit.”

Lenny Kravitz and Gina Gershon

Lenny Kravitz and Gina Gershon backstage at the Rock'n'Road Rally party in 2000


Steve Azzara / Getty Images

Suggested by: kaylayandoli

Their backstory: Kravitz and Gershon went to the same high school in Los Angeles, along with another famous classmate: Nicolas Cage (then Nicolas Coppola). They were involved in school plays together, like Oklahoma!, with Gershon in the lead acting role and Kravitz playing drums in the pit.

They’ve stayed close over the years — Gershon even appeared as Kravitz’s girlfriend in his music video, “Again,” in the early 2000s.

Connie Britton and Lauren Graham

In honor of the babely @conniebritton birthday, let’s all party like its 1999! (Photo from 1999 for reference).


@thelaurengraham / Via Twitter: @thelaurengraham

Suggested by: lauraa44514358a

Their backstory: Before they made it big in TV and movies, Britton and Graham met at an acting class in New York City — they eventually became roommates once they moved to Los Angeles. At Vulture Fest in 2015, Britton said: “We had a friend who was going through a divorce, so she had a house that was mostly empty. Thankfully, there were a couple of bedrooms with a couple of beds in them, so we were set!”
